Gretchen Parlato And Lionel Loueke ‘Lean In’ On New Duet Album

Two people play instruments and sing against a grey background.

A long-awaited collaboration between GRAMMY-nominated vocalist Gretchen Parlato and acclaimed guitarist Lionel Loueke, Lean In tells the story of 20 years of connection, inspiration and friendship between two musical soulmates.

Reflecting on the great musical duos of our time and what it is that makes them essential, it would seem plausible that there would be at least a short list of common foundational factors necessary for success. For eminent artists, vocalist-arranger Gretchen Parlato and guitarist-vocalist Lionel Loueke, their formula is anchored in what could initially seem to be contrasting components —intrinsic rootedness paired with freedom, spontaneity, and impulse. The development of an earthy connection lays the groundwork for the confidence and trust required for experimentation and ascension. Of their affecting, palpable synergy, Loueke has endearingly coined the term “Musical Soul Mate.”

“It’s somebody who finishes your musical sentences, so to speak,” says Parlato. “We are challenging each other at the same time,” adds Loueke. “I just go wherever she is and vice versa. So, there’s no comfort zone. We get into the Unknown Zone.”

However, it is the uncharted territory that Parlato and Loueke would have to traverse off the bandstand that has produced their first formal duo recording project. Conceptualized, written, and recorded while in the grips of a global pandemic, Lean In bears the various loads of the last three years: a worldwide public health crisis, the traumatic losses of black life, police brutality, devastating wildfires across the world, an economic recession, a tense election punctuated by insurrection of the nation’s capital, and a myriad of civil and human rights hanging in the balance.

Lean In is an offering conceived through the lens of two friends and collaborators who were decidedly vulnerable about an unforeseeable journey that would challenge all of us, both individually and collectively, in unprecedented ways. The result is a palpably soul-stirring set that fully captures the charisma and ingenuity of deeply feeling artists and the perspectives that developed during the most trying of times. Now labelmates, and exactly 20 years after each of their moves to New York City, Parlato and Loueke created the album fans of their live sets have been anticipating for some time.
